SWDEV-335780 - Indicate if handler is queued

Maintain status of handler callback. For event records we no longer
submit callbacks to reduce the load on the async handler thread. However
without a callback we leak command memory/decrement refcounts. Indicate
status of the handler which we can use to queue a callback when
finish is called.
